Deputy Returning Officer & Poll Clerk Guidebook–Mobile Poll

Returning Material

This section explains how to pack up your materials at the end of the day. You will end up with a Transport Bag containing the official voting documents, ballots etc., and a second Transport Bag with extra supplies and items not needed again.

How do I organize and return my material?

  5. Gather the following items – on a separate table if possible:

    • EC 10002 Record of Ballots
    • EC 50036 Helper Form — only completed ones
    • EC 50034 Qualification Form — only completed ones
    • EC 50052 Transfer Certificate — only completed ones
    • EC 50060 Events Log
    • EC 50090 Tally Sheet — only completed ones
    • EC 50110 Copy of Results for Candidates — only completed ones
    • EC 50420 Envelope: Stubs and Unused Ballots — sealed
    • EC 50430 Envelope: Spoiled Ballots — sealed
    • EC 50440 Envelope: Rejected Ballots — sealed
    • EC 50450 Envelope: Ballots Cast for a Candidate — sealed, one for each candidate
    • EC 50490 Mobile Poll Bag — make sure it is empty
    • ☐ List of Electors
    • ☐ Plastic bag with counterfoils
